Description:
|
Day to day operations of the Data Center network and security devices. Creating firewall rules, configuring SSL appliances, network load balancers, switches and routers. Provide network and security support for our existing Data Center network and firewall devices to include core switch configurations/modifications, network interfaces to servers, load balancing, SSL, VPN support, Firewall rule implementation and maintenance, load testing, and fault management; Produce detailed network diagrams in Visio.Current; working knowledge of equipment such as CISCO 6500 with FWSM, CSM, CSS, CheckPointFW, Alteon, Nortel Passport; Maintains documentation of all servers, applications and network components at the data centers to include IP address, physical connections, physical and logical data flows and work flows; Works with OIR and agencies to determine DR solutions for applications across both data centers; Manages network related disaster recovery events, real and exercises; Reviews designs and solution options and provides reactive and proactive changes to network hardware and software components to ensure that user requirements are met and that the network is performing at optimum levels; Provides level 2 and 3 support for fault management and problem resolution; Works with network engineering group to establish standards and to put designed solutions in place.
